body,ul,li,i,a,img,div,p,h1,h2,h3,h4,h5,h6,span,em,table,tr,td,dd,dl,dt,ol{padding:0; margin:0;border:none;}
ul,ol,li{list-style:none;}
a{text-decoration:none;}
.margin5{margin:5px;}
.margin10{margin:10px;}
.fl{float:left;}
.fr{float:right;}
.clear{clear:both;}
.marginbottom{padding-bottom:60px}
.marginbottom40{padding-bottom:40px}
a,input,button{ outline:none; }
::-moz-focus-inner{border:0px;}
/*header*/
header{ position:relative;width:100%;background:#fff;z-index:99;top:0;}
header img{width:100%}
header .logo{width:129px;padding:17px 10px 12px;}
header .nav_btn{width:75px;padding:17px 10px 12px;background:#000;}
header .nav_btn a { font-size:18px; color:#fff;}
header .am-offcanvas-bar{background:#fff;width:200px;}
header .am-offcanvas-content{color:#fff;padding:15px 0;}
header .am-offcanvas-content ul li:first-of-type{border-bottom:none;margin-bottom:20px;}
header .am-offcanvas-content ul li{border-bottom:1px solid #eee;}
header .am-offcanvas-content ul li a{text-align:left;padding:8px 20px 8px 20px;color:#333;}
header .am-offcanvas-bar:after{width:0;}
header .to_nav2 i{transform:rotate(0deg);font-style: normal;width:16px;margin-top:-1px;}
header .to_nav2.active i{transform:rotate(180deg);}
header .nav2{display:none;padding-left:20px;}
header .nav2 li{border-bottom:none !important;border-top:1px solid #eee;}
header .nav2 li:first-of-type{margin-bottom:0 !important;}
header .nav2.active{display:block;}
/**/
/*nav*/
nav{background:#fff;float:left;width:100%;}
nav ul{border-top:1px solid #f2f2f2;border-left:1px solid #f2f2f2;}
nav ul li{float:left;width:33.33%;text-align:center;}
nav ul li a{color:#999;border-right:1px solid #f2f2f2;border-bottom:1px solid #f2f2f2;display:block;font-size:14px;line-height:28px;}
nav ul li.active a,nav ul li:hover a{color:#10A0EA;}

/**/
/*footer*/
footer{background:url(../../images/mobile/footer_bg.png) no-repeat;background-size:100% 100%;text-align:center;}
footer .information{text-align:center;padding-top:34px;padding-bottom:36px;}
footer .information img{width:100%;}
footer .information a{width:40px;margin-right:5%;display:inline-block;}
footer .information a:last-of-type{margin-right:0;}
footer .txt{margin-bottom:28px;}
footer .company{font-size:15px;color:#d0cdcd;line-height:18px;}
footer .address{font-size:12px;color:#d0cdcd;line-height:16px;}
footer .copyright{font-size:11px;color:#d0cdcd;padding-bottom:21px;line-height:16px;}

/**/
.content{margin-top:0px; background:#f2f2f2;}
/*index*/
.index_banner{position:relative;overflow:hidden;}
.index_banner img{width:100%;}
.index_banner .wrapper{width:300%;float: left;position:relative;}
.index_banner .wrapper li{width:33.333%;float:left;}
.index_banner .pagination{text-align: center;position:absolute;bottom:10px;width:100%;}
.index_banner .pagination .page{width:12px;height:12px;border-radius:100%;background:#fff;display:inline-block;margin:0 5px;}
.index_banner .pagination .page.active{background:#0a75b3;}
.product{text-align:center;width:100%;float:left;padding-bottom:40px;}
.product1{background:#fff;}
.product2{background:#f2f2f2;}
.product h3{font-size:22px;color:#333;margin-top:40px;margin-bottom:10px;}
.product h3 span{color:#fdd10d;}
.product p{color:#666;font-size:12px;margin-bottom:25px;}
.product .slider{float:left;width:90%;margin:0 5%;overflow:hidden; position:relative;}
.product .slider .wrapper{position:relative;float:left;}
.product .slider .wrapper li{float:left;width:320px;position:relative;}
.product .slider .wrapper li p{color:#fff;background:rgba(0,0,0,0.5);position:absolute;bottom:0;z-index:9;margin-bottom:0;height:30px;line-height:30px;font-size:14px;width:100%;}
.product .slider .wrapper img{width:100%;float:left;}
.product .slider .next,.slider .prev{position:absolute;width:25px;height:40px;top:50%;margin-top:-20px;}
.product .slider .next img,.slider .prev img{width:100%;}
.product .slider .next{right:0;transform:rotate(180deg);-webkit-transform:rotate(180deg);-moz-transform:rotate(180deg);}

.application{text-align:center;width:100%;float:left;padding-bottom:40px;background:#fff;}
.application h3{font-size:22px;color:#333;margin-top:40px;margin-bottom:10px;}
.application h3 span{color:#1e8ccc;}
.application p{color:#666;font-size:12px;margin-bottom:25px;}
.application ul{width:100%;}
.application ul li{width:49%;float:left;margin-right:2%;margin-bottom:8px;}
.application ul li:nth-of-type(even){margin-right:0;}
.application ul li img{float:left;width:100%;}
.application ul li p{float:left;color:#fff;background:#0a75b3;margin-bottom:0;height:40px;line-height:40px;font-size:12px;width:100%;}
.application .button_box{width:100%;float:left;margin-top:20px;}
.application .button_box a{border-radius:4px;border:1px solid #0a75b3;font-size:15px;display:inline-block;width:140px;line-height:32px;height:30px;color:#0a75b3;}

.why_choose_us{text-align:center;width:100%;float:left;padding-bottom:40px;background:#fff;}
.why_choose_us h3{font-size:22px;color:#333;margin-top:10px;margin-bottom:10px;}
.why_choose_us h3 span{color:#1e8ccc;}
.why_choose_us p{color:#666;font-size:12px;margin-bottom:25px;}
.why_choose_us .picture{width:80%;margin:0 auto;}
.why_choose_us .picture img{width:100%;}

.join_us{background:url(../../images/mobile/join_us_bg.png) no-repeat;background-size:100% 100%;text-align:center;width:100%;float:left;padding-bottom:40px;}
.join_us h3{font-size:22px;color:#fff;margin-top:40px;margin-bottom:10px;}
.join_us h3 span{color:#fdd10d;}
.join_us p{color:#fff;font-size:12px;margin-bottom:0px;margin-top:70px;padding:0 30px;text-align:left;line-height:18px;}

.news_box{text-align:center;width:100%;float:left;padding-bottom:40px;background:#fff;}
.news_box h3{font-size:22px;color:#333;margin-top:10px;margin-bottom:10px;}
.news_box h3 span{color:#1e8ccc;}
.news_box p{color:#666;font-size:12px;margin-bottom:25px;}
.news_box ul{padding:0 10px;}
.news_box ul li{padding:4px 15px 4px;background:#0a75b3;color:#fff;text-align:left;margin-bottom:10px;}
.news_box ul li h5{color:#fff;font-weight:normal;font-size:14px;line-height:36px;border-bottom:1px solid #fff;}
.news_box ul li p{color:#fff;font-size:11px;line-height:20px;margin-bottom:0;padding:2px 0;}
.news_box .button_box{width:100%;float:left;margin-top:20px;}
.news_box .button_box a{border-radius:4px;border:1px solid #0a75b3;font-size:15px;display:inline-block;width:140px;line-height:32px;height:30px;color:#0a75b3;}

.partner{text-align:center;width:100%;float:left;padding-bottom:40px;}
.partner h3{font-size:22px;color:#333;margin-top:10px;margin-bottom:10px;}
.partner h3 span{color:#1e8ccc;}
.partner p{color:#666;font-size:12px;margin-bottom:25px;}
.partner .scroll{overflow:hidden;height:80px;}
.partner .scroll .wrapper{overflow-x:scroll;overflow-y:hidden;height:95px;}
.partner .scroll ul{white-space:nowrap;height:80px;float:left;overflow-x:visible;}
.partner .scroll li{height:80px;display:inline-block;margin-right:10px;}
.partner .scroll li img{height:100%;}
/**/

.banner{width:100%;}
.banner img{width:100%;}

/*list_box*/
.list_box{padding:0 10px;margin-top:-19px;position:relative;z-index:9;margin-bottom:60px;}
.list_box .box_style1,.list_box .box_style2{background:#333;float:left;position:relative;width:100%;margin-bottom:2px;}
.list_box .txt{background:#333;color:#fff;width:50%;text-align:center;}
.list_box .txt a{color:#fff;}
.list_box .txt h4{margin-top:10%;font-size:18px; font-weight:normal;}
.list_box .txt h5{color:#fdd10d;font-size:12px;}
.list_box .txt p{padding:0 15px;font-size:11px;margin-bottom:5px;}
.list_box .txt span{border:1px solid #fff;border-radius:5px;font-size:11px;color:#fff;padding:2px 12px;margin-bottom:10px;display:inline-block;}
.list_box .pic{width:50%;}
.list_box .pic img{width:100%;height:100%;}
.list_box .box_style1 .txt{float:left;}
.list_box .box_style1 .pic{float:right;}
.list_box .box_style2 .txt{float:right;}
.list_box .box_style2 .pic{float:left;}
/**/

/*view_box*/
.view_box{margin:-19px 10px 0;position:relative;z-index:9;padding-bottom:60px;background:#fff;}
.view_box .view_style1{background:#fff;position:relative;width:100%;text-align:center;}
.view_box .view_style1 h4{color:#333;font-size:22px;padding-top:43px;line-height:1em;font-weight:normal;}
.view_box .view_style1 img{width:100%;margin-top:20px;}
.view_box .view_style1 .hr{width:115px;margin:0 auto;}
.view_box .view_style1 .hr img{margin-top:0;}
.view_box .view_style1 ul{margin-top:25px;}
.view_box .view_style1 li{text-align:left;padding:0 15px;height:32px;line-height:32px;font-size:13px;color:#666;}
.view_box .view_style1 li:nth-of-type(odd){background:#e7e7e7;}
.view_box .view_style1 p{line-height:18px;font-size:12px;color:#666;padding:20px 10px;}
.view_box .view_style1 .pic img{margin:0;width:49%;margin-right:2%;margin-bottom:6px;float:left;}
.view_box .view_style1 .pic img:nth-of-type(even){margin-right:0;}
/**/

/*view_box2*/
.view_box2{margin:-19px 10px 0;position:relative;z-index:9;padding-bottom:60px;background:#fff;}
.view_box2c{margin-left:10px;margin-right:10px;}
.view_box2 h3{font-size:22px; color:#0a75b3;text-align:center;padding-top:43px;font-weight:normal;}
.view_box2 .view_style1{background:#fff;position:relative;width:100%;text-align:center;}
.view_box2 .view_style1 h5{color:#333;font-size:15px;padding-top:30px;line-height:1em;}
.view_box2 .view_style1 img{width:100%;margin-top:20px;}
.view_box2 .view_style1 .hr{width:115px;margin:0 auto;}
.view_box2 .view_style1 .hr img{margin-top:0;}
.view_box2 .view_style1 ul{margin-top:25px;}
.view_box2 .view_style1 li{text-align:left;padding:0 15px;height:32px;line-height:32px;font-size:13px;color:#666;}
.view_box2 .view_style1 li:nth-of-type(odd){background:#e7e7e7;}
.view_box2 .view_style1 p{line-height:18px;font-size:13px;color:#666;padding:20px 15px;text-align:left;}
.view_box2 .view_style1 .pic img{margin:0;width:49%;margin-right:2%;margin-bottom:6px;float:left;}
.view_box2 .view_style1 .pic img:nth-of-type(even){margin-right:0;}
/**/

/*about*/
.overview_of_our_business{background:#fff;margin:-19px 10px 0;position:relative;z-index:9;text-align:center;}
.overview_of_our_business h2{font-size:22px;font-weight:normal;padding-top:55px;padding-bottom:17px;}
.overview_of_our_business h5{font-weight:normal;font-size:12px;text-transform:Uppercase;color:#1e8ccc;padding-bottom:50px;}
.overview_of_our_business img{width:100%;margin-bottom:57px;}
.overview_of_our_business h4{font-size:18px;color:#1e8ccc;}
.overview_of_our_business h4 span{font-size:20px;color:#ccc;}
.overview_of_our_business p{padding:10px 32px 25px;font-size:12px;text-align:left;}
.title_bg{width:100%;position:relative;margin-top:-18px;}


.our_honorary_qualifications{margin:-108px 10px 0;position:relative;z-index:9;text-align:center;}
.our_honorary_qualifications h2{color:#fff;font-weight:normal;font-size:22px;}
.our_honorary_qualifications h5{color:#fdd10d;font-weight:normal;font-size:12px;margin-bottom:27px;text-transform:Uppercase;}
.our_honorary_qualifications .scroll{overflow:hidden;height:165px;background:#fff;padding-top:10px;}
.our_honorary_qualifications .scroll .wrapper{overflow-x:scroll;overflow-y:hidden;height:180px;}
.our_honorary_qualifications .scroll ul{white-space:nowrap;height:165px;float:left;overflow-x:visible;}
.our_honorary_qualifications .scroll li{height:165px;display:inline-block;margin-right:15px;}
.our_honorary_qualifications .scroll li img{height:100%;}
.our_honorary_qualifications h4{background:#fff;padding-top:32px;font-size:18px;color:#1e8ccc;}
.our_honorary_qualifications h4 span{font-size:20px;color:#ccc;}
.our_honorary_qualifications p{background:#fff;padding:10px 32px 25px;font-size:12px;text-align:left;}

.our_service_client{margin:-108px 10px 0;position:relative;z-index:9;text-align:center;}
.our_service_client h2{color:#fff;font-weight:normal;font-size:22px;}
.our_service_client h5{color:#fdd10d;font-weight:normal;font-size:12px;margin-bottom:27px;text-transform:Uppercase;}
.our_service_client img{width:100%;}
.our_service_client h4{background:#fff;padding-top:43px;font-size:18px;color:#1e8ccc;}
.our_service_client h4 span{font-size:20px;color:#ccc;}
.our_service_client p{background:#fff;padding:10px 32px 25px;font-size:12px;text-align:left;}


.more_products_and_services{margin:-108px 10px 0;position:relative;z-index:9;text-align:center;}
.more_products_and_services h2{color:#fff;font-weight:normal;font-size:22px;}
.more_products_and_services h5{color:#fdd10d;font-weight:normal;font-size:12px;margin-bottom:27px;text-transform:Uppercase;}
.more_products_and_services .product .slider{width:100%;margin:0;}
.more_products_and_services .product h3{clear:both;padding:20px 0 0;margin:0;}

.contact_us{background:#1e8ccc;text-align:center;clear:both;}
.contact_us h3{color:#fff;font-weight:normal;font-size:18px;line-height:24px;padding-top:20px;}
.contact_us p{color:#fff;font-size:12px;line-height:18px;margin-top:10px;}
.contact_us a{color:#fff;background:#00649e;height:30px;padding:0 22px;display:inline-block;margin-top:20px;margin-bottom:30px;}
.contact_us a:hover{color:#fff;}
.contact_us input{width:70%;background:#fff;padding:0 12px;height:40px;font-size:13px;line-height:40px;border-radius:5px;border:none;margin-bottom:10px;color:#333;}
.contact_us textarea{width:70%;background:#fff;padding:2px 12px;height:90px;font-size:13px;border-radius:5px;border:none;margin-bottom:10px;color:#333;}
.contact_us button{width:45%;background:#00649e;padding:2px 12px;height:40px;font-size:15px;border-radius:40px;border:none;margin-bottom:10px;color:#fff;}
/**/

/*详情翻页*/
.page{font-size:12px;background:#fff;}
.page .arrow{width:40px;height:40px;}
.page .page_left{float:left;width:49%;background:#1e8ccc;text-align:left;-webkit-box-sizing: border-box;box-sizing: border-box;padding:10px; color:#fff;}
.page .page_left .arrow{float:left;background:url(../../images/mobile/arrow_left.png)no-repeat;background-size:100% 100%;margin-right:3px;transform:rotate(0deg);-webkit-transform:rotate(0deg);-moz-transform:rotate(0deg);}
.page .page_right{float:right;width:49%;background:#1e8ccc;text-align:right;webkit-box-sizing: border-box;box-sizing: border-box;padding:10px; color:#fff;}
.page .page_right .arrow{float:right;background:url(../../images/mobile/arrow_left.png)no-repeat;background-size:100% 100%;margin-left:3px;transform:rotate(180deg);-webkit-transform:rotate(180deg);-moz-transform:rotate(180deg);}

.page .page_left.none{background:none;border-top:1px solid #999;}
.page .page_left.none p{color:#666;}
.page .page_left.none span{color:#999;}
.page .page_left.none .arrow{background: url(../../images/mobile/arrow_right.png)no-repeat;background-size: 100% 100%;transform:rotate(180deg);-webkit-transform:rotate(180deg);-moz-transform:rotate(180deg);}

.page .page_right.none{background:none;border-top:1px solid #999;}
.page .page_right.none p{color:#666;}
.page .page_right.none span{color:#999;}
.page .page_right.none .arrow{background: url(../../images/mobile/arrow_right.png)no-repeat;background-size: 100% 100%;transform:rotate(0deg);-webkit-transform:rotate(0deg);-moz-transform:rotate(0deg);}

/**/
<!--吊车系列-->
.pro_box{ width:100%; height:auto; background:#f0f0f0; position:relative;min-width: 1200px;}
.pro_box .crane_box{ top:-60px; z-index:999; padding-bottom:40px;}
.pro_box .crane{ width:100%;min-width: 1200px; margin-bottom:60px;}
.crane li{ width:50%; height:300px; float:left;background: #fff ;}
.crane li a{ display: block; width:50%; height:100%; background:#333333; float:left;}
.crane li a:hover{ background:#262626;}
.crane li a h2{ font-size:20px; text-align:center; padding-top:100px; color:#FFFFFF;}
.crane li a h3{ font-size:12px; font-weight:bold; color:#fdd10d; margin:5px 0 20px 0; text-align:center;}
.crane li a .cr_text{ font-size:12px; color:#FFFFFF; width:210px; overflow:hidden; margin:0 auto 30px auto;}
.crane li a  span{ display:block; width:140px; height:26px; border:solid #FFFFFF 1px; margin:0 auto;font-size:12px; color:#FFFFFF; line-height:26px; text-align:center;}
.crane li img{ width:50%; height:100%; float:left;}

.stu_btn{ width:100%; height:34px; text-align:center; background:#FFFFFF; margin:;}
.stu_btn dt{ display:inline-block; width:52px; height:32px; margin-right:10px;}
.stu_btn dt a,.stu_btn dd a{ display:inline-block; width:100%; border:solid #cccccc 1px; height:100%; font-size:16px; color:#333333; line-height:32px; background:#FFFFFF;}
.stu_btn dt a:hover,.stu_btn dd a:hover,.stu_btn .current{ background:#1e8ccc; color:#FFFFFF; border:none; line-height:34px; height:34px;}
.stu_btn dt a:hover,.stu_btn dt .current{ width:54px;}
.stu_btn dd a:hover,.stu_btn dd .current{ width:34px;}
.stu_btn dd{ display:inline-block; width:32px; height:32px; margin-right:10px;}
.no_bg{ background:none;}

